Skip to content

Commit 6ebffd1

Browse files
committed
metabase nginx proxy timeout
1 parent f636873 commit 6ebffd1

2 files changed

Lines changed: 7 additions & 6 deletions

File tree

metabase/metabase.sls

Lines changed: 6 additions & 6 deletions
Original file line numberDiff line numberDiff line change
@@ -35,9 +35,9 @@ nginx_separated_config:
3535
ssl_certificate_key /opt/acme/cert/metabase_{{ domain["name"] }}_key.key;
3636
{%- for instance in domain["instances"] %}
3737
location /{{ instance["name"] }}/ {
38-
proxy_connect_timeout 300;
39-
proxy_read_timeout 300;
40-
proxy_send_timeout 300;
38+
proxy_connect_timeout {{ instance["nginx_proxy_timeout"] if "nginx_proxy_timeout" in instance else 300 }};
39+
proxy_read_timeout {{ instance["nginx_proxy_timeout"] if "nginx_proxy_timeout" in instance else 300 }};
40+
proxy_send_timeout {{ instance["nginx_proxy_timeout"] if "nginx_proxy_timeout" in instance else 300 }};
4141
proxy_buffering off;
4242
proxy_pass http://localhost:{{ instance["port"] }}/;
4343
}
@@ -78,9 +78,9 @@ nginx_files_1:
7878
ssl_certificate_key /opt/acme/cert/metabase_{{ domain["name"] }}_key.key;
7979
{%- for instance in domain["instances"] %}
8080
location /{{ instance["name"] }}/ {
81-
proxy_connect_timeout 300;
82-
proxy_read_timeout 300;
83-
proxy_send_timeout 300;
81+
proxy_connect_timeout {{ instance["nginx_proxy_timeout"] if "nginx_proxy_timeout" in instance else 300 }};
82+
proxy_read_timeout {{ instance["nginx_proxy_timeout"] if "nginx_proxy_timeout" in instance else 300 }};
83+
proxy_send_timeout {{ instance["nginx_proxy_timeout"] if "nginx_proxy_timeout" in instance else 300 }};
8484
proxy_buffering off;
8585
proxy_pass http://localhost:{{ instance["port"] }}/;
8686
}

metabase/pillar.example

Lines changed: 1 addition &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-50,6 +50,7 @@ metabase:
5050
plugins: # use to install clickhouse plugin
5151
clickhouse: 0.7.5
5252
java_timezone: UTC
53+
#nginx_proxy_timeout: 300 # optional, nginx proxy timeouts, 300 by default
5354
db:
5455
type: postgres
5556
host: metabase1.example.com

0 commit comments

Comments
 (0)